White House says Hur tapes are privileged as Congress moves to hold Garland in contempt

President Biden has asserted executive privilege over the audio and video recordings from the special counsel investigation into his handling of classified materials and will refuse congressional requests to hand them over, the White House and the Justice Department said in separate letters to House Republican leaders Thursday.

The letters were sent hours before the GOP-led House Oversight and Judiciary committees were scheduled to advance a contempt resolution against Attorney General Merrick Garland for defying a subpoena that demanded the recordings, which include hours of special counsel Robert K. Hur interviewing Biden.
